Output d66ff36c3835fa47dbd28d7ce3b95f8ce91d1d7ada2a8df2a6a3b8d571a2a70a:0

value
695300
script pubkey
OP_0 OP_PUSHBYTES_20 2f377599f963acc531dc90063490d3bf364cdd1a
address
bc1q9umhtx0evwkv2vwujqrrfyxnhumyehg62zk344
transaction
d66ff36c3835fa47dbd28d7ce3b95f8ce91d1d7ada2a8df2a6a3b8d571a2a70a
confirmations
137151
spent
true